(ns dev.gethop.object-storage.s3
(:require [amazonica.aws.s3 :as aws-s3]
[amazonica.core :refer [ex->map]]
[clojure.spec.alpha :as s]
[dev.gethop.object-storage.core :as core]
[integrant.core :as ig]
[lambdaisland.uri :refer [map->query-string query-map uri]])
(:import [com.amazonaws.services.s3.model ResponseHeaderOverrides]
[java.net URL]
[java.util Date]))
(def ^:const default-presigned-url-lifespan
"Default presigned urls lifespan, expressed in minutes"
60)
(defn- ex->result
"Create a result map from `e` exception details"
[e]
(cond
(instance? com.amazonaws.AmazonServiceException e)
{:success? false
:error-details (dissoc (ex->map e) :stack-trace)}
:else
(let [error-details {:message (.getMessage ^Exception e)}]
{:success? false
:error-details (cond-> error-details
(instance? com.amazonaws.AmazonClientException e)
(assoc :error-type "Client"))})))
(s/def ::AWSS3Bucket (s/keys :req-un [::bucket-name ::presigned-url-lifespan]))
(defn- put-object*
"Put `object` in the S3 bucket referenced by `this`, using `object-id` as the key.
Use `opts` to specify additional put options.
`object` can be either a File object or an InputStream. In the
latter case, if you know the size of the content in the InputStream,
add the `:metadata` key to the `opts` map. Its value should be a map
with a key called `:object-size`, with the size as its value."
[this object-id object opts]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/object object)
(s/valid? ::core/put-object-opts opts))]}
(try
(let [metadata (:metadata opts)
encryption (:encryption opts)
request {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:key object-id
:file object}
request (cond-> request
(instance? java.io.InputStream object)
(->
(dissoc :file)
(assoc :input-stream object)
(assoc-in [:metadata :content-length] (:object-size metadata)))
encryption
(assoc :encryption encryption)
(:explicit-object-acl this)
(assoc :access-control-list (:explicit-object-acl this)))]
;; putObject either succeeds or throws an exception
(if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/put-object request)
(aws-s3/put-object {:endpoint (:endpoint this)} request))
{:success? true})
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ef put-object*
:args ::core/put-object-args
:ret ::core/put-object-ret)
(defn- copy-object*
"Copy `source-object-id` object into `destination-object-id` object.
For now there is no support to copy objects between different
Buckets. Also encryption is only supported just as a side-effect of
copying an already encrypted object. There is no support to change
the original encryption or metadata for now.
Use `opts` to specify additional options. Right now there is no one
supported."
[this source-object-id destination-object-id opts]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id source-object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id destination-object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/copy-object-opts opts))]}
(try
(let [b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
request {:source-bucket-name bucket-name
:destination-bucket-name bucket-name
:source-key source-object-id
:destination-key destination-object-id}
request (cond-> request
(:explicit-object-acl this)
(assoc :access-control-list (:explicit-object-acl this)))]
;; copyObject either succeeds or throws an exception
(if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/copy-object request)
(aws-s3/copy-object {:endpoint (:endpoint this)} request))
{:success? true})
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ef copy-object*
:args ::core/copy-object-args
:ret ::core/copy-object-ret)
(defn- get-object*
"Get the object with key `object-id` from S3 bucket referenced by `this`, using `opts` options"
[this object-id opts]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/get-object-opts opts))]}
(try
(let [encryption (:encryption opts)
request {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:key object-id}
request (cond-> request
encryption
(assoc :encryption encryption))
result (if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/get-object request)
(aws-s3/get-object {:endpoint (:endpoint this)} request))]
;; getObject can return null in some cases. Quoting
;; documentation "When specifying constraints in the request
;; object, the client needs to be prepared to handle this method
;; returning null if the provided constraints aren't met when
;; Amazon S3 receives the request."
(if result
{:success? true
:object (:input-stream result)}
{:success? false
:error-details {:error-code "RequestConstraintsNotMet"}}))
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ef get-object*
:args ::core/get-object-args
:ret ::core/get-object-ret)
(defn- kw->http-method
[k]
{:pre [(s/valid? ::core/method k)]}
(k {:create "PUT" :read "GET", :update "PUT", :delete "DELETE"}))
(defn- attachment-header
[content-disposition content-type filename]
(let [rho (ResponseHeaderOverrides.)
cd (str (case content-disposition
:attachment "attachment"
:inline "inline")
"; filename=" filename)]
(-> rho
(.withContentType content-type)
(.withContentDisposition cd))))
(defn- presigned-url->public-url
[presigned-url]
(let [filtered-query-string (-> (query-map presigned-url {})
(select-keys [:response-content-disposition :response-content-type])
map->query-string)
public-uri (assoc (uri presigned-url)
:fragment nil
:query filtered-query-string)]
(str public-uri)))
(defn- get-object-url*
"Generates a url allowing access to the object without the need to auth oneself.
Uses the object with key `object-id` from S3 bucket referenced by
`this`, using `opts` options."
[this object-id opts]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/get-object-url-opts opts))]}
(try
(let [expiration (Date. (+ (System/currentTimeMillis)
(int (* (double (:presigned-url-lifespan this)) 60 1000))))
method (:method opts)
content-disposition (get opts :content-disposition :attachment)
content-type (get opts :content-type "application/octet-stream")
filename (:filename opts)
object-public-url? (:object-public-url? opts)
request {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:key object-id
:expiration expiration}
request (cond-> request
method
(assoc :method (kw->http-method method))
filename
(assoc :response-headers (attachment-header content-disposition
content-type
filename)))
presigned-url (if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/generate-presigned-url request)
(aws-s3/generate-presigned-url {:endpoint (:endpoint this)}
request))]
;; generatePresignedUrl either succeeds or throws an exception
{:success? true
:object-url (if object-public-url?
(presigned-url->public-url (.toString ^URL presigned-url))
(.toString ^URL presigned-url))})
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ef get-object-url*
:args ::core/get-object-url-args
:ret ::core/get-object-url-ret)
(defn- delete-object*
"Delete the object `object-id` from S3 bucket referenced by `this`
Use `opts` to specify additional delete options."
[this object-id opts]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id object-id)
(s/valid? ::core/delete-object-opts opts))]}
(try
;; deleteObject either succeeds or throws an exception
(if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/delete-object {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this), :key object-id})
(aws-s3/delete-object {:endpoint (:endpoint this)}
{:bucket-name (:bucket-name this) :key object-id}))
{:success? true}
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ef delete-object*
:args ::core/delete-object-args
:ret ::core/delete-object-ret)
(defn- build-object-list
"Build a list of all child objects for the given `parent-object-id`
from S3 bucket reference by `this`. As an S3 bucket can contain a
virtually unlimited number of objects, listObjectsV2 paginates the
results. This function takes care of looping while there are still
objects pending."
[this parent-object-id]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id parent-object-id))]}
(loop [object-list []
partial-list (if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/list-objects-v2 {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:prefix (str parent-object-id)})
(aws-s3/list-objects-v2 {:endpoint (:endpoint this)}
{: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:prefix (str parent-object-id)}))]
(if-not (:truncated? partial-list)
(concat object-list (:object-summaries partial-list))
(let [object-list (concat object-list (:object-summaries partial-list))
continuation-token (:next-continuation-token partial-list)]
(recur object-list
(if-not (:endpoint this)
(aws-s3/list-objects-v2 {: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:prefix (str parent-object-id)
:continuation-token continuation-token})
(aws-s3/list-objects-v2 {:endpoint (:endpoint this)}
{:bucket-name (:bucket-name this)
:prefix (str parent-object-id)
:continuation-token continuation-token})))))))
(defn- list-objects*
"Lists all child objects for the given `parent-object-id` from S3
bucket referenced by `this`."
[this parent-object-id]
{:pre [(and (s/valid? ::AWSS3Bucket this)
(s/valid? ::core/object-id parent-object-id))]}
(try
(let [result (build-object-list this parent-object-id)]
{:success? true
:objects (pmap (fn [{:keys [key last-modified size]}]
{:object-id key
:last-modified last-modified
:size size})
result)})
(catch Exception e
(ex->result e))))
(s/fdef list-objects*
:args ::core/list-objects-args
:ret ::core/list-objects-ret)
(defrecord AWSS3Bucket [bucket-name presigned-url-lifespan]
core/ObjectStorage
(put-object [this object-id object]
(put-object* this object-id object {}))
(put-object [this object-id object opts]
(put-object* this object-id object opts))
(copy-object [this source-object-id destination-object-id]
(copy-object* this source-object-id destination-object-id {}))
(copy-object [this source-object-id destination-object-id opts]
(copy-object* this source-object-id destination-object-id opts))
(get-object [this object-id]
(get-object* this object-id {}))
(get-object [this object-id opts]
(get-object* this object-id opts))
(get-object-url [this object-id]
(get-object-url* this object-id {}))
(get-object-url [this object-id opts]
(get-object-url* this object-id opts))
(delete-object [this object-id]
(delete-object* this object-id {}))
(delete-object [this object-id opts]
(delete-object* this object-id opts))
(list-objects [this parent-object-id]
(list-objects* this parent-object-id))
(list-objects [this parent-object-id _opts]
(list-objects* this parent-object-id)))
(defmethod ig/init-key :dev.gethop.object-storage/s3 [_ {:keys [bucket-name presigned-url-lifespan
endpoint explicit-object-acl]
:or {presigned-url-lifespan default-presigned-url-lifespan
endpoint nil
explicit-object-acl nil}}]
(map->AWSS3Bucket {:bucket-name bucket-name
:endpoint endpoint
:explicit-object-acl explicit-object-acl
:presigned-url-lifespan presigned-url-lifespan}))
